Holman Takes Full Ownership of ARIZA in Mexico
Holman is bringing its Mexican fleet management operation fully under its own brand after more than 30 years as a joint venture. The change gives multinational fleet customers a single Holman operation across the U.S., Canada, and Mexico.

For more than 30 years, Holman’s fleet management presence in Mexico has operated through its ARIZA joint venture with Corporación Zapata.

Holman has acquired full ownership of ARIZA, its fleet management joint venture in Mexico, bringing the operation entirely under the Holman brand.
ARIZA previously operated as a 50/50 joint venture between Holman and Corporacion Zapata. As part of the acquisition, ARIZA will retire its name, and the company's operations will transition to Holman.
The move expands Holman's directly operated fleet management presence in Mexico and is intended to simplify fleet management for customers operating vehicles across multiple North American countries.
A 30-Year Fleet Partnership
ARIZA was established in 1995 as a joint venture between Holman and Corporación Zapata, focused on supporting multinational fleets operating in Mexico.
Following the acquisition, ARIZA's existing team, operations, and customer relationships will join Holman.
“Holman is honored and grateful to have partnered with the Zapata family on this successful joint venture for more than 30 years,” said Chris Conroy, CEO of Holman. “Bringing ARIZA fully into Holman reflects our confidence in the Mexico market [and] our commitment to supporting customers across North America.”
What Changes for Fleet Customers?
Holman said customers operating across the U.S., Canada, and Mexico will have a single point of contact and more consistent processes across the three countries.
The integration also brings the Mexican operation's fleet services directly into Holman's broader North American fleet management organization.
ARIZA's physical locations, website, digital properties, and customer-facing materials will transition to the Holman name and brand identity.
For multinational fleets, the change consolidates a joint-venture operation in Mexico with Holman's existing operations elsewhere in North America.
